remapear a tecla caps lock para menor que maior que e chave pipe

0

Eu recentemente mudei de laptop para desktop. Mas eu tenho um problema.

Comprei um teclado barato de porcelana. No entanto, este pacote de teclado dizia que isso era bom para o mapa de teclado alemão. Após a inspeção, verifica-se que não tem a chave de maior que o menor que a de pipe.

Veja a imagem, veja a chave entre o shift esquerdo e a tecla y - essa tecla está faltando.

Eu sei que posso comprar outro teclado, mas no espírito do unix, eu gostaria de remapear a tecla capslock para a chave que está faltando.

Eu olhei para o arquivo: / usr / share / X11 / xkb / symbols / de

Mas ficou bastante confuso. Por favor, ajude.

    
por Sean 05.06.2017 / 19:49

1 resposta

1

Se você estiver executando o X e não o Wayland, usar xmodmap em vez de xkbd será muito mais fácil (embora as pessoas digam que xmodmap está obsoleto, mas as pessoas contam isso há uma década e ainda está lá).

Muito brevemente: execute xmodmap -pke , encontre código de tecla para maiúscula e maior / menor chave, execute xmodmap -e 'keycode 123 = ... , onde 123 é o código de tecla para capslock e ... é a definição da chave maior / menor.

Se funcionar, coloque a linha em ~/.Xmodmap , ~/.Xkeyboard ou qualquer coisa que seu gerenciador de exibição leia no login.

    
por 06.06.2017 / 06:22